The DMK government in Tamil Nadu is prioritizing the rights and welfare of differently abled persons, according to Deputy Chief Minister Udhayanidhi Stalin. The government is focusing on education, sports, and employment opportunities to improve their lives.

Financial assistance ranging from Rs 2,000 to Rs 1 lakh is being provided to support their education, while Rs 5 crore has been allocated to differently abled students participating in international sports competitions. Additionally, Rs 25 crore has been disbursed as prize money for victorious athletes.

The government plans to offer more employment opportunities through its sports department, setting a target to provide jobs to 20 differently-abled athletes. Recent initiatives include distributing assistive devices and launching low-floor buses across the state to facilitate inclusivity.
